Book My Vaccine (external link) Before you book, check the … WebApr 13, 2024 · The over-75s are being urged to book a slot for a coronavirus booster jab. Appointments will be available in England from Monday. Covid-19 hospital admissions remain highest among the over-75s, with the rate currently standing at 34.9 admissions per 100,000 people for 75-84 year olds and 74.5 per 100,000 for those aged 85 and above.
